COVID-19 ticket rates high in Nova Scotia

Nova Scotians were ticketed for violating COVID-19 emergency measures at a higher rate than all other Canadians. Those findings come from a new report, and the authors say education is the key to public compliance — not giving police sweeping enforcement powers. Alexa MacLean has the details.
